Puerto Princesa City, the heart of Palawan, is a paradise of natural wonders and cultural heritage. Known as the "City in a Forest," it boasts pristine beaches, lush jungles, and the world-renowned Puerto Princesa Underground River,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Visitors can explore breathtaking limestone caves, vibrant marine ecosystems, and diverse wildlife, making the city a top eco-tourism destination.
Beyond its natural beauty, Puerto Princesa embraces a rich cultural identity. The city is home to indigenous communities, historical landmarks, and lively festivals that celebrate its traditions. Tourists can visit heritage sites, enjoy authentic local cuisine, and experience warm Filipino hospitality. Sustainable tourism practices ensure that both locals and visitors contribute to the preservation of its natural and cultural treasures.
Committed to responsible tourism, Puerto Princesa promotes eco-friendly initiatives, marine conservation, and community-driven projects. From island-hopping adventures to nature trails and city tours, travelers can immerse themselves in a harmonious blend of adventure and relaxation. The Puerto Princesa Underground River is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of the New 7 Wonders of Nature located in Palawan, Philippines.
